    I’ve been playing FF15 and decided to switch the language to English out of curiosity. Gotta say, this might be a rare Spanish translation W. Some things that stand out:

    • every quest rhymes in Spanish while most don’t have any wordplay in English
    • Noct’s magic abilities are in Latin in Spanish, but have generic names in English
    • Many abilities have different descriptions so one or both of these languages must be wrong

    Also the summons are called the Sidereals instead of the Hexatheon, the royal weapons have unique names and are called the Spectral Chorus instead of the Armiger, and the Chocobo post is called la Chocoberiza (a play on caballeriza).

        Ah, by magic abilities I mean the special powers he gets from his royal bloodline. In Spanish it’s called the gift of Lux and every related skill has that moniker: warping is called Lux Impetus, perfect guards are called Lux Custodia, the thing that distracts enemies is called Lux Fatua, etc.
